History

History is the study of past events, particularly in human affairs. It encompasses a chronological record of significant occurrences and developments, including the social, political, economic, and cultural dimensions of societies over time. Historians analyze written documents, oral traditions, artifacts, and other sources to reconstruct historical narratives and understand the causes and effects of past actions and events. History not only chronicles events but also interprets the impact of these events on the present and future. It aids in the understanding of human behavior, societal changes, and the evolution of civilizations. Through the lens of history, we explore the complexities of human experience, the interconnectedness of events, and the lessons that can be drawn from the past.
